EVAL-ADXRS290Z-M

Analog Devices Inc.
The ADXRS290 is a high performance pitch and roll (dual-axis in-plane) angular rate sensor (gyroscope) designed for use in stabilization applications.The ADXRS290 provides an output full-scale range of ±100°/s with a sensitivity of 200 LSB/°/s. Its resonating disk sensor structure enables angular rate measurement about the axes normal to the sides of the package around an in-plane axis. Angular rate data is formatted as 16-bit twos complement and is accessible through a SPI digital interface. The ADXRS290 exhibits a low noise floor of 0.004°/s/√Hz and features programmable high-pass and low-pass filters.The ADXRS290 is available in a 4.5 mm × 5.8 mm × 1.2 mm, 18-terminal cavity laminate package.APPLICATIONS Optical image stabilization Platform stabilization Wearable products

ADXRS624BBGZ

Analog Devices Inc.
The ADXRS624 is a complete angular rate sensor (gyroscope) that uses the Analog Devices, Inc., surface-micromachining process to create a functionally complete and low cost angular rate sensor integrated with all required electronics on one chip. The manufacturing technique for this device is the same high volume BiMOS process used for high reliability automotive airbag accelerometers.The ADXRS624 is an automotive grade gyroscope. Automotive grade gyroscopes have more extensive guaranteed min/max specifications due to automotive testing.The output signal, RATEOUT (1B, 2A), is a voltage proportional to angular rate about the axis normal to the top surface of the package. The output is ratiometric with respect to a provided reference supply. A single external resistor between SUMJ and RATEOUT can be used to lower the scale factor. An external capacitor sets the bandwidth. Other external capacitors are required for operation. A temperature output is provided for compensation techniques. Two digital self-test inputs electromechanically excite the sensor to test proper operation of both the sensor and the signal conditioning circuits. The ADXRS624 is available in a 7 mm × 7 mm × 3 mm BGA chip scale package.APPLICATIONS Navigation systems Inertial measurement units Platform stabilization Robotics

EVAL-ADXL346Z-M

Analog Devices Inc.
The ADXL346 is a small, thin, ultralow power, 3-axis accelerometer with high resolution (13-bit) measurement at up to ±16g. Digital output data is formatted as 16-bit twos complement and is accessible through either an SPI (3- or 4-wire) or I2C® digital interface.The ADXL346 is well suited for mobile device applications. It measures the static acceleration of gravity in tilt-sensing applications, as well as dynamic acceleration resulting from motion or shock. Its high resolution (4 mg/LSB) enables measurement of inclination changes of less than 1.0°.Several special sensing functions are provided. Activity and inactivity sensing detect the presence or lack of motion by comparing the acceleration on any axis with user-set thresholds. Tap sensing detects single and double taps in any direction. Free-fall sensing detects if the device is falling. Orientation detection is capable of concurrent four- and six-position sensing and a user-selectable interrupt on orientation change for 2D or 3D applications. These functions can be mapped individually to either of two interrupt output pins. An integrated, patent pending memory management system with 32-level first in, first out (FIFO) buffer can be used to store data to minimize host processor activity and lower overall system power consumption.Low power modes enable intelligent motion-based power management with threshold sensing and active acceleration measurement at extremely low power dissipation.The ADXL346 is supplied in a small, thin, 3 mm × 3 mm × 0.95 mm, 16-lead, plastic package.APPLICATIONS Handsets Medical instrumentation Gaming and pointing devices Industrial instrumentation Personal navigation devices Hard disk drive (HDD) protection

ADXL322JCP-REEL7

Analog Devices Inc.
The ADXL322 is an ultra small package (4 × 4 × 1.45 mm LFCSP) and low power (340 µA at VS = 2.4V) ± 2 g iMEMS® accelerometer designed to accommodate the integration requirements of mobile phones and other portable devices for a variety of motion, tilt, and inertial sensing features (e.g., data entry, menu and display control, power management, situational awareness, navigation, and portrait vs. landscape display orientation). The ADXL322 also enables hard disk drive protection systems and security features in notebook computers, as well as position and tilt sensing for PC and gaming peripherals such as mouse and joystick devices.APPLICATIONS Cost Sensitive Motion- and Tilt-Sensing Applications Mobile Phones Hard Disk Drive Protection Gaming User Interface Peripherals Sports and Health Related Devices

AD22100AT

Analog Devices Inc.
The AD22100 is a monolithic temperature sensor with on-chip signal conditioning. It can be operated over the temperature range -50°C to +150°C, making it ideal for use in numerous HVAC, instrumentation and automotive applications.The signal conditioning eliminates the need for any trimming, buffering or linearization circuitry, greatly simplifying the system design and reducing the overall system cost.The output voltage is proportional to the temperature times the supply voltage (ratiometric). The output swings from 0.25 V at -50°C to +4.75 V at +150°C using a single +5.0 V supply.Due to its ratiometric nature, the AD22100 offers a cost effective solution when interfacing to an analog-to-digital converter. This is accomplished by using the ADC's +5 V power supply as a reference to both the ADC and the AD22100 (See Figure 2 of the datasheet), eliminating the need for and cost of a precision reference to both the ADC and the AD22100 eliminating the need for and cost of a precision reference (see Figure 2).APPLICATIONS HVAC systems System temperature compensation Board level temperature sensing Electronic thermostatsMARKETS Industrial process control Instrumentation Automotive

AD22105ARZ-REEL

Analog Devices Inc.
The AD22105 is a solid state thermostatic switch. Requiring only one external programming resistor, the AD22105 can be set to switch accurately at any temperature in the wide operating range of -40°C to +150°C. Using a novel circuit architecture, the AD22105 asserts an open collector output when the ambient temperature exceeds the user-programmed setpoint temperature. The AD22105 has approximately 4°C of hysteresis which prevents rapid thermal on/off cycling.The AD22105 is designed to operate on a single power supply voltage from +2.7 V to +7.0 V facilitating operation in battery powered applications as well as in industrial control systems. Because of low power dissipation (230 µW @ 3.3 V), self-heating errors are minimized and battery life is maximized.An optional internal 200 k(ohm) pull-up resistor is included to facilitate driving light loads such as CMOS inputs.Alternatively, a low power LED indicator may be driven directly. APPLICATIONS Industrial process control Thermal control systems CPU monitoring Computer thermal management circuits Fan control Handheld/portable electronic equipment

AD7416ARMZ

Analog Devices Inc.
The AD7417 and AD7418 are 10-bit, 4-channel and single-channelADCs with an on-chip temperature sensor that can operate from asingle 2.7 V to 5.5 V power supply. The devices contain a 15 μssuccessive approximation converter, a 5-channel multiplexer, atemperature sensor, a clock oscillator, a track-and-hold, and areference (2.5 V). The AD7416 is a temperature-monitoring onlydevice in an 8-lead package.The temperature sensor on the parts can be accessed via multiplexerChannel 0. When Channel 0 is selected and a conversionis initiated, the resulting ADC code at the end of the conversiongives a measurement of the ambient temperature (±1°C @ 25°C).On-chip registers can be programmed with high and low temperaturelimits, and an open-drain overtemperature indicator (OTI)output is provided, which becomes active when a programmedlimit is exceeded.A configuration register allows programming of the sense of theOTI output (active high or active low) and its operating mode(comparator or interrupt). A programmable fault queue counterallows the number of out-of-limit measurements that mustoccur before triggering the OTI output to be set to preventspurious triggering of the OTI output in noisy environments.An I2C® compatible serial interface allows the AD7416/AD7417/AD7418 registers to be written to and read back. The threeLSBs of the AD7416/AD7417 serial bus address can be selected,which allows up to eight AD7416/AD7417 devices to be connectedto a single bus.The AD7417 is available in a narrow body, 0.15 inch, 16-lead,small outline package (SOIC) and in a 16-lead, thin shrink,small outline package (TSSOP). The AD7416 and AD7418 areavailable in 8-lead SOIC and MSOP packages. Product Highlights The AD7416/AD7417/AD7418 have an on-chip temperature sensor that allows an accurate measurement of the ambient temperature (±1°C @ 25°C, ±2°C overtemperature) to be made. The measurable temperature range is −40°C to +125°C. An overtemperature indicator is implemented by carrying out a digital comparison of the ADC code for Channel 0 (temperature sensor) with the contents of the on-chip TOTI setpoint register. The AD7417 offers a space-saving, 10-bit analog-to-digital solution with four external voltage input channels, an onchip temperature sensor, an on-chip reference, and a clock oscillator. The automatic power-down feature enables the AD7416/ AD7417/AD7418 to achieve superior power performance. At slower throughput rates, the part can be programmed to operate in a low power shutdown mode, allowing further savings in power consumption.Applications Data acquisition with ambient temperature monitoring Industrial process control Automotive Battery-charging applications Personal computers

ADXL325BCPZ-RL7

Analog Devices Inc.
The ADXL325 is a small, low power, complete 3-axis accelerometer with signal conditioned voltage outputs. The product measures acceleration with a minimum full-scale range of ±5 g. It can measure the static acceleration of gravity in tilt-sensing applications, as well as dynamic acceleration, resulting from motion, shock, or vibration.The user selects the bandwidth of the accelerometer using the CX, CY, and CZ capacitors at the XOUT, YOUT, and ZOUT pins. Bandwidths can be selected to suit the application with a range of 0.5 Hz to 1600 Hz for X and Y axes and a range of 0.5 Hz to 550 Hz for the Z axis.The ADXL325 is available in a small, low profile, 4 mm × 4 mm × 1.45 mm, 16-lead, plastic lead frame chip scale package (LFCSP_LQ).
